[ARCHIVED] 8/28/25 - Road Improvements & SRTS Projects Update

Worthington Hills residents, Decker Construction plans to return in mid-September to continue the Road Improvements Project. They have two other projects in Franklin county to complete first - one in Jefferson Township and one in Prairie Township - before resuming work on Candlewood Dr. The dates and times on the no-parking signs will be updated as we get closer to construction restarting.

The one-way traffic pattern on Candlewood Dr will remain in place until the project is completed. We would like to avoid any confusion or disruption that could result from temporarily removing the traffic pattern only to reinstate it shortly after. The Road Improvements Project steps and traffic pattern are all available on the website: https://www.perrytwp.org/2361/2025-Perry-Township-Road-Improvements

Additionally, the Safe Routes to School (SRTS) project by both Worthington Hills Elementary and Brookside Elementary will begin around the second week of September. Please note that the SRTS project is separate from the Road Improvements Project. The SRTS project plans are available on the Township website: https://www.perrytwp.org/2327/2025-SRTS-Sidewalk-Construction-Projects

Updates will be sent to residents once we know the exact dates of construction. If you have any questions about either project, please contact Road Superintendent Ian Warren: iwarren@perrytwp.org or 614-889-8781.
